1. Stay in History: The Historic Inns of Annapolis

For travelers who appreciate history and charm, the Historic Inns of Annapolis provide a unique lodging experience in the heart of downtown. This collection includes three beautifully restored properties:

  • The Maryland Inn – A colonial-era hotel featuring grand architecture and antique furnishings.
  • Governor Calvert House – Once home to a colonial governor, this inn offers a mix of historic charm and modern comfort.
  • Robert Johnson House – A more intimate option, perfect for those seeking a quiet retreat near the city’s attractions.

Each of these inns offers easy access to the U.S. Naval Academy, Main Street, and the Maryland State House. Whether you're in town for a historic tour or a special event, the inns provide a blend of luxury and history that makes for an unforgettable stay.

2. Hotels with Modern Comfort: Waterfront Views & Business-Friendly Stays

For visitors seeking modern amenities, convenient locations, and full-service accommodations, hotels in Annapolis and the surrounding areas offer plenty of choices.

One of the top options is the Annapolis Waterfront Hotel, Autograph Collection, part of the Marriott brand. Located directly on the waterfront, it offers stunning views of the Chesapeake Bay, making it an ideal spot for boaters, wedding guests, and business travelers.

If you're looking for a business-friendly stay near Riva, Maryland, the Courtyard by Marriott Annapolis is a great choice. Conveniently located near the Riva Business District, this hotel offers:

  • Spacious rooms with workspaces
  • High-speed Wi-Fi
  • An on-site fitness center
  • Close proximity to Annapolis’ major attractions
